Namibia Year
WorldTeach volunteers in Namibia teach a range of subjects in a range of different placements. Volunteers' jobs include teaching English, Math, and/or Science, at elementary, middle and high schools throughout the country. Most placements are in rural areas, with some in larger towns and cities. Participants gain valuable work experience abroad while forming meaningful relationships with both local Namibians and fellow volunteers. Approaching our twentieth year of partnership with the Namibian Ministry of Education, we are proud to continue serving the Ministry in its efforts towards equitable and quality education for all Namibian students.
